Output e866666cd18810722bd659876b978fdb672a369e984cb69a9137bd2b986adfd7:40

value
22290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6b60e272839847c7a516bf54e46dc7b17804afb4054b3c8574628633a3b46c4
address
bc1p66mqufeg8xz8c7j3d065u3ku0vtcqjhmgp2t8jzhgc5xxw3mgmzqmvuae0
transaction
e866666cd18810722bd659876b978fdb672a369e984cb69a9137bd2b986adfd7
spent
true